### The Shift in Financial Workforce Dynamics

Multi Ways Holdings, operating within the financial services sector, finds itself amidst a significant shift in workforce dynamics, exemplified by recent decisions made by major players like Morgan Stanley. The Wall Street firm plans to lay off approximately 2,000 employees, representing 2% to 3% of its workforce, as part of a strategic move to enhance operational efficiency. This decision, which is not directly linked to market conditions, reflects a broader trend among financial institutions as they adapt to evolving economic landscapes. Such workforce reductions indicate a critical moment for the industry, where firms are reassessing their structures and prioritizing strategic growth areas, particularly in investment banking.

The implications of these layoffs extend beyond mere numbers; they illustrate the pressures facing financial institutions in an era of uncertainty. While Morgan Stanley is reducing staff, it simultaneously aims to bolster senior-level growth within its investment banking division. This dual approach highlights the complexities of navigating a challenging market, where firms must balance cost-cutting measures with the need to remain competitive and innovative. The current environment, influenced by geopolitical factors such as tariff threats, forces companies to reconsider their operational strategies and workforce allocations carefully.

### Broader Industry Trends

The current wave of layoffs in the financial sector is not isolated to Morgan Stanley; firms like Goldman Sachs and Bank of America have also announced staff reductions in response to shifting economic conditions. Goldman Sachs plans to cut 3% to 5% of its workforce, while Bank of America has recently removed 150 junior banker positions. These actions reflect a cautious approach to managing resources as firms brace for potential market volatility stemming from policy uncertainties.
